Chris Kelly, Half Of 90s Rap Duo Kris Kross, Dies At 34

Chris Kelly, half of the 1990s kid rap duo Kris Kross who made one of the decade’s most memorable songs with the frenetic “Jump,” has died, according to authorities. He was 34.

Hip-Hop Pioneer KDAY May Go Mandarin Amid Sale Rumors

A Southland radio station best known for playing West Coast hip-hop and R&B music in its heyday during the mid-1990s will likely be sold, according to reports Thursday.

Sean ‘Diddy’ Combs In Beverly Hills Car Crash

Sean “Diddy” Combs was a passenger in an SUV that was hit by another car in front of the Beverly Hills Hotel on Wednesday, but the hip-hop and fashion mogul was not taken to a hospital.

Grammy Museum Puts Spotlight On Hip Hop Music, Culture

A new exhibit opened at the Grammy Museum as part of Grammy Week festivities, putting the spotlight on the culture and lifestyle inspired by hip hop music.
